[리팩토링]구린내 나는 코드 sungjin 2019년 10월 2일 개발 0 댓글 –구린내 나는 코드 (응집도가 낮고 결합도가 높은 코드) 중복 코드 – 메소드 추출, 템플릿 메서드 형성, 알고리즘 전환,클래스 추출, 모듈 추출 장황한 메서드 – 메소드를…
[리팩토링]프로그램의 가치를 높이는 기술 sungjin 2019년 9월 30일 개발 0 댓글 최근 리팩토링의 필요성을 많이 느끼면서 관련된 책을 구매했습니다. 책보며 공부한 내용을 블로그에 정리해보려고 합니다. 1장 예제에서 불필요한 변수 제거, 임시 변수 제거, 자신이 사용하는 데이터와…